What is postgresql-13-pgpool2
postgresql-13-pgpool2 is:
pgpool-II is a middleware that works between PostgreSQL servers and a PostgreSQL database client. This package contains support modules for the PostgreSQL 13 server:
- pgpool_adm
- pgpool_recovery (PostgreSQL 9.1 and above)
- pgpool_regclass (PostgreSQL 9.1 and above)

Install postgresql-13-pgpool2 Using apt-get
Update apt database with apt-get
using the following command.
sudo apt-get update
After updating apt database, We can install postgresql-13-pgpool2
using apt-get
by running the following command:
sudo apt-get -y install postgresql-13-pgpool2

How To Uninstall postgresql-13-pgpool2 on Kali Linux
To uninstall only the postgresql-13-pgpool2
package we can use the following command:
sudo apt-get remove postgresql-13-pgpool2
Uninstall postgresql-13-pgpool2 And Its Dependencies
To uninstall postgresql-13-pgpool2
and its dependencies that are no longer needed by Kali Linux, we can use the command below:
sudo apt-get -y autoremove postgresql-13-pgpool2
Remove postgresql-13-pgpool2 Configurations and Data
To remove postgresql-13-pgpool2
configuration and data from Kali Linux we can use the following command:
sudo apt-get -y purge postgresql-13-pgpool2
Remove postgresql-13-pgpool2 configuration, data, and all of its dependencies
We can use the following command to remove postgresql-13-pgpool2
configurations, data and all of its dependencies, we can use the following command:
sudo apt-get -y autoremove --purge postgresql-13-pgpool2
